# Server-side Client in Mini oRPC
The server-side client transforms procedures into callable functions, enabling direct server-side invocation.
> The complete Mini oRPC implementation is in the [Mini oRPC Repository](https://github.com/middleapi/mini-orpc).
## Implementation
**`server/src/procedure-client.ts`:**
```ts
import { ORPCError } from '@mini-orpc/client'
import { ValidationError } from './error'
export function createProcedureClient<TInitialContext, TInputSchema, TOutputSchema>(
procedure: Procedure<TInitialContext, any, TInputSchema, TOutputSchema>,
...rest: MaybeOptionalOptions<CreateProcedureClientOptions<TInitialContext>>
): ProcedureClient<TInputSchema, TOutputSchema> {
const options = resolveMaybeOptionalOptions(rest)
return (...[input, callerOptions]) => {
return executeProcedureInternal(procedure, {
context: options.context ?? {},
input,
path: options.path ?? [],
procedure,
signal: callerOptions?.signal,
})
}
}
async function validateInput(procedure, input) {
const schema = procedure['~orpc'].inputSchema
if (!schema) return input
const result = await schema['~standard'].validate(input)
if (result.issues) {
throw new ORPCError('BAD_REQUEST', {
message: 'Input validation failed',
data: { issues: result.issues },
cause: new ValidationError({
message: 'Input validation failed',
issues: result.issues,
}),
})
}
return result.value
}
async function validateOutput(procedure, output) {
const schema = procedure['~orpc'].outputSchema
if (!schema) return output
const result = await schema['~standard'].validate(output)
if (result.issues) {
throw new ORPCError('INTERNAL_SERVER_ERROR', {
message: 'Output validation failed',
cause: new ValidationError({
message: 'Output validation failed',
issues: result.issues,
}),
})
}
return result.value
}
function executeProcedureInternal(procedure, options) {
const middlewares = procedure['~orpc'].middlewares
const inputValidationIndex = 0
const outputValidationIndex = 0
const next = async (index, context, input) => {
let currentInput = input
if (index === inputValidationIndex) {
currentInput = await validateInput(procedure, currentInput)
}
const mid = middlewares[index]
const output = mid
? (await mid({
...options,
context,
next: async (...[nextOptions]) => {
const nextContext = nextOptions?.context ?? {}
return {
output: await next(index + 1, { ...context, ...nextContext }, currentInput),
context: nextContext,
}
},
})).output
: await procedure['~orpc'].handler({
...options,
context,
input: currentInput,
})
if (index === outputValidationIndex) {
return await validateOutput(procedure, output)
}
return output
}
return next(0, options.context, options.input)
}
```
## Router Client
```ts
export function createRouterClient<T extends AnyRouter>(
router: T,
...rest: MaybeOptionalOptions<CreateProcedureClientOptions<InferRouterInitialContexts<T>>>
): RouterClient<T> {
const options = resolveMaybeOptionalOptions(rest)
if (isProcedure(router)) {
return createProcedureClient(router, options) as RouterClient<T>
}
const recursive = new Proxy(router, {
get(target, key) {
if (typeof key !== 'string') return Reflect.get(target, key)
const next = get(router, [key]) as AnyRouter | undefined
if (!next) return Reflect.get(target, key)
return createRouterClient(next, {
...options,
path: [...toArray(options.path), key],
})
},
})
return recursive as unknown as RouterClient<T>
}
```
## Usage
```ts
const procedureClient = createProcedureClient(myProcedure, {
context: { userId: '123' },
})
const result = await procedureClient({ input: 'example' })
const routerClient = createRouterClient(myRouter, {
context: { userId: '123' },
})
const result2 = await routerClient.someProcedure({ input: 'example' })
```
